Roy Keane: 'Next few days' key amid Sunderland manager job links
Roy Keane has hinted he could become Sunderland manager again and suggested the next few days will determine whether he returns to the Sky Bet League One club.
The former Republic of Ireland and Manchester United captain has been linked with returning to the club he managed between 2006 and 2008 and led into the Premier League.
Asked about speculation surrounding a return, Keane told ITV: "I've made it clear over the last few years I'd like to go back as a manager.
"But, of course, a club has to want you, you have to want to go to that club. Just as important the contract has got to be right. We'll see how things take shape over the next few days."
